SABES is proud to announce that we will be co-sponsoring with WE LEARN an important professional development opportunity. It is with great pleasure that that we invite you to participate in the seminar: The Impact of Violence on Learning: Building Connections to Deepen Understanding.
March 8, 2007
The Impact of Violence on Learning:
Building Connections to Deepen Understanding
One-day knowledge exchange seminar
Facilitated by Jenny Horsman with Judy Hofer and others
Location: Egan Center, Northeastern University, Boston, MA
Co-Sponsors: WE LEARN (Providence, RI), Spiral Community Resource Group (Toronto), The Bread and Roses Project (Toronto), and SABES (MA).
The one-day seminar will bring together 60 practitioners and learners from Canada and the United States who have done tremendous work on this issue - to learn from and to inspire each other. If you are looking for an opportunity to deepen your understanding, strengthen your resolve, and find allies in making real changes in programming, then this one-day seminar is for you.
The seminar is free to practitioners and ABE students from Massachusetts, though application to attend is required. This one-day seminar precedes a two-day conference (March 9-10, 2007) hosted by WE LEARN, a small organization based in New England. The theme for this year's annual women and literacy networking conference is, Threads of Experience: Creative Spaces for Women's Learning. If you are unable to attend the Pre-conference Seminar, or are just beginning to consider these issues in your program, the seminar participants will be making a presentation about their discussion during the conference. WE LEARN promotes women's literacy as a tool for personal growth and social change through networking, education, action and resource development. We hope you will also participate in the conference.
